After connecting on match.com, Fallon and Bill met for a drink in April 2009. Although she was initially skeptical about online dating, the pair hit it off instantly. An in-person meeting for a quick drink turned into a five-hour conversation that ended only because the bar closed. By October, Bill was spreading a blanket for a picnic, uncorking a bottle of wine, reciting a love letter he crafted, and asking Fallon to marry him. “It just felt right,” she says.
Fallon chose to return to her hometown of Duxbury, Massachusetts, to tie the knot. An ocean-side estate across the street from Fallon’s childhood home was the perfect setting to celebrate the couple’s love of the outdoors amidst their favorite colors of green and blue

This slightly larger wedding budget is also for 100-125 guests. Several details tweak the budget up just a bit—but several cost-saving details help keep it from launching way into the next budgetary stratosphere. This is where picking your priorities is critical. One splurge here is the striking gown, at around $4,000. The other is the dog’s floral collar, with stems that are more expensive than those in the bride’s bouquet!
